Как работает кэширование информации

Кэширование информации представляет собой методологию хранения дубликатов сведений в быстродоступном хранилище. Система генерирует дубликаты нередко запрашиваемых файлов и помещает их ближе к клиенту. Процесс запускается с первичного обращения к ресурсу, когда сведения загружаются из первичного источника и параллельно записываются в выделенном хранилище.

При следующем обращении система контролирует наличие требуемой данных в кэше. Если дубликат найдена и актуальна, загрузка происходит из промежуточного хранилища. Такой подход уменьшает время отклика, поскольку данные извлекаются из памяти устройства 1 вин вместо удаленного сервера.

Принцип работы построен на принципе близости. Система изучает модели запросов и выявляет наиболее запрашиваемые компоненты. Изображения, сценарии, таблицы стилей попадают в кэш автоматически после первичного загрузки веб-страницы.

Система использует разные слои сохранения. Процессор применяет внутреннюю память для команд. Операционная система применяет оперативную память для программных сведений. Веб-приложения записывают содержимое на диске юзера через 1вин вход инструменты браузера, обеспечивая оперативный доступ к источникам.

Что такое кэш доступными терминами

Кэш является собой переходное хранилище для временных копий данных. Технология дает системе запоминать данные, которая может пригодиться повторно. Вместо очередной скачивания файлов устройство задействует сохраненные версии из локального хранилища.

Принцип функционирования напоминает блокнот с пометками. Человек записывает важные сведения, чтобы не искать их заново в руководстве. Компьютер функционирует аналогично, сохраняя части веб-страниц, изображения, видеофайлы в выделенной зоне памяти. При следующем запросе система использует эти копии вместо исходного сервера.

Буферное хранилище размещается на разных уровнях структуры. Процессор имеет собственный кэш для ускорения операций. Жесткий диск хранит информацию браузера и приложений. Оперативная память сохраняет активные процессы для быстрого доступа.

Емкость кэша лимитирован техническими ресурсами устройства. Система самостоятельно контролирует содержанием, стирая неактуальные файлы и высвобождая пространство для свежих. Клиент может воздействовать на 1win конфигурации хранилища, корректируя опции браузера или стирая сохраненные файлы самостоятельно.

Зачем системам сохранять временные копии информации

Основная задача сохранения временных копий состоит в снижении времени доступа к сведениям. Системы исключают очередных обращений к отдаленным серверам, применяя локальные дубликаты файлов. Темп извлечения информации из памяти устройства превосходит темп скачивания через интернет в десятки раз.

Экономия сетевого трафика становится важным плюсом системы. Клиенты с лимитированным интернет-пакетом тратят меньше мегабайт при посещении привычных сайтов. Браузер загружает лишь измененные элементы страницы, а прочий содержимое извлекает из 1 вин локального хранилища.

Сокращение нагрузки на серверы дает обрабатывать больше запросов синхронно. Сайты отдают неизменные файлы реже, концентрируясь на переменном материале. Разделение функций между клиентским кэшем и серверной архитектурой повышает суммарную скорость.

Офлайновая функционирование приложений гарантируется благодаря записанным дубликатам. Клиент может просматривать прежде полученные страницы без подключения к сети. Портативные программы применяют сохраненные сведения при прерывистом соединении, гарантируя доступ к функциям даже в условиях слабой коннекта.

Как кэш ускоряет загрузку страниц и программ

Повышение скачивания реализуется за счет устранения задержек сетевого связи. Браузер получает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у отнимает сотни миллисекунд. Отличие становится особенно заметной при слабом интернете или удаленном местоположении сервера.

Постоянные элементы веб-страниц скачиваются instantly благодаря кешированию. Логотипы, шрифты, таблицы стилей, скрипты фиксируются после первичного визита. При следующем открытии сайта система применяет подготовленные элементы из онлайн казино временного хранилища, направляя запросы только для свежего материала.

Программы задействуют многослойное кэширование для улучшения функционирования. Операционная система содержит библиотеки в оперативной памяти. Приложения записывают клиентские параметры на накопителе. Такая организация обеспечивает запускать приложения оперативнее и переключаться между задачами без задержек.

Предварительная подгрузка элементов увеличивает темп навигации. Браузер изучает организацию сайта и предварительно сохраняет элементы ассоциированных страниц. Пользователь следует по гиперссылкам фактически instantly, поскольку необходимые файлы уже размещены в кэше устройства.

Где используется кэш: браузер, сервер, устройство

Браузеры записывают веб-содержимое в выделенной директории на жестком диске юзера. Картинки, видеофайлы, таблицы стилей, JavaScript-файлы попадают в хранилище самостоятельно при просмотре веб-страниц. Каждый браузер управляет собственным кэшем автономно от прочих программ.

Серверы используют кеширование для уменьшения нагрузки на базы данных. Готовые HTML-страницы записываются в памяти вместо генерации при каждом обращении. Буферные прокси-серверы сохраняют популярный контент, разделяя его между юзерами. Сети передачи материала размещают копии файлов в разнообразных географических местах.

Процессоры включают внутренние слои кэша для команд и информации. L1-кэш находится прямо в ядре и предоставляет моментальный доступ. L2 и L3 слои обладают расширенный размер, но работают медленнее. Многоуровневая структура оптимизирует равновесие между быстродействием и объемом хранилища 1win.

Операционные системы кешируют файлы и библиотеки в оперативной памяти. Часто используемые программы загружаются оперативнее благодаря упреждающему помещению элементов. Портативные устройства хранят информацию программ местно, обеспечивая работу при отсутствии подключения к сети.

Что совершается при обновлении информации

При актуализации данных на хранилище возникает расхождение между текущей редакцией и кэшированной копией. Система обязана выявить, какая данные устарела и нуждается замены. Браузер контролирует метки времени файлов и сопоставляет их с сохраненными редакциями.

Серверы применяют специальные заголовки для контроля процессом обновления. Настройки указывают срок валидности сохраненного контента и правила его использования. Когда срок жизни копии истекает, браузер отправляет обращение для верификации свежести онлайн казино через систему верификации.

Процесс согласования охватывает несколько стадий:

  • Контроль периода валидности записанных файлов по временным штампам
  • Отправка условного обращения на сервер для сравнения редакций
  • Скачивание обновленного контента при выявлении правок
  • Замена старых копий актуальными сведениями в хранилище

Стратегии обновления варьируются в зависимости от категории содержимого. Постоянные файлы могут храниться долгое время без верификаций. Изменяемые веб-страницы нуждаются постоянной проверки. Программисты конфигурируют стратегии кэширования персонально для каждого вида файлов.

Почему временами кэш вызывает ошибки показа

Сбои показа возникают из-за употребления неактуальных версий файлов. Браузер скачивает сохраненные дубликаты вместо актуального материала с хранилища. Юзер замечает старый внешний вид страницы, неработающие опции или некорректное расположение элементов.

Несоответствие версий случается при актуализации сайта программистами. Новые стили и скрипты несовместимы со старыми HTML-шаблонами из кэша. Страница 1 вин собирается из элементов разных поколений, что приводит к графическим нарушениям через комбинирование несогласованных компонентов.

Повреждение сохраненных сведений провоцирует неполадки в функционировании программ. Файлы могут быть записаны не полностью из-за прерывания связи или сбоев накопителя. Браузер старается задействовать испорченные копии, что приводит к отсутствию изображений или некорректной разметке.

Ошибочные конфигурации периода валидности кэша порождают трудности согласования. Хранилище задает излишне долгий срок хранения для переменного контента. Пользователь продолжает замечать неактуальную данные даже после размещения изменений. Браузер не верифицирует свежесть данных до завершения заданного времени.

Как стирается и актуализируется кэш

Самостоятельное удаление совершается по достижении лимита дискового объема. Браузер удаляет устаревшие файлы по методу замещения, очищая место для актуальных информации. Система изучает частоту обращений к дубликатам и стирает наименее популярные элементы.

Ручная очистка осуществляется через параметры браузера или программы. Клиент указывает срок стирания данных и категории файлов для стирания. Действие стирает все записанные дубликаты, вынуждая систему скачивать контент вновь через онлайн казино повторное обращение к хранилищам.

Жесткое обновление страницы дает получить новую редакцию без полного очистки кэша. Комбинация клавиш минует местное хранилище и получает все компоненты с хранилища. Браузер заменяет устаревшие копии свежими файлами.

Софтверное контроль кэшем выполняется через выделенные инструменты программиста. Дополнения браузера автоматизируют процесс стирания по расписанию. Серверные конфигурации управляют стратегию актуализации через заголовки ответов, устанавливая срок актуальности каждого типа контента и условия верификации информации.

Польза кэширования для быстродействия и нагрузки

Кэширование существенно сокращает время ответа сайтов и программ. Пользователь обретает доступ к материалу за доли секунды вместо ожидания загрузки с отдаленного хранилища. Моментальное загрузка страниц повышает оценку платформы и увеличивает довольство аудитории.

Снижение нагрузки на серверную инфраструктуру позволяет обрабатывать больше клиентов синхронно. Сайты экономят процессорные ресурсы и пропускную способность каналов коммуникации. Распределение постоянного содержимого через кэш освобождает мощности для обработки переменных запросов через оптимизацию организации системы 1win.

Сокращение трафика становится критичной для мобильных устройств с лимитированными планами. Последующие визиты на ресурсы не тратят мегабайты из тарифа клиента. Программы скачивают исключительно обновленные данные, минимизируя количество отправляемой данных.

Надежность функционирования увеличивается благодаря местным дубликатам информации. Временные неполадки подключения не перекрывают доступ к ранее загруженному контенту. Юзер продолжает функционировать с программой даже при нестабильном связи, а система синхронизирует правки после восстановления соединения.

Noticias relacionadas